**DULUTH, MN (October 26, 2025)** – A significant winter storm is expected to impact the region this weekend, bringing heavy snow and a wintry mix to northern Minnesota and Wisconsin. Friday will see mostly sunny skies with highs ranging from the low 30s to low 40s, before a cold front moves in, bringing increased NW winds (10-20 mph) and a chance of rain/snow showers.

Saturday will be mostly sunny and cool, with highs in the mid-20s to low 30s and light southerly winds. However, a winter storm system will arrive overnight, bringing snow and a wintry mix from west to east after midnight.

The storm will intensify Sunday, bringing heavy, wet snow north of the Twin Ports and a wintry mix south of the ports. The wintry mix is expected to transition to all snow around midday. Temperatures near freezing will result in heavy, wet snow that is difficult to remove. Snowfall will continue overnight Sunday and taper off Monday morning. Total accumulations are forecast to be 4-8 inches across the region, with 8-12 inches possible along the North Shore. Lower amounts are anticipated immediately lakeside due to the moderating effect of Lake Superior. Gusty east winds (10-20 mph) are expected throughout Sunday.
